+static int scx_kfunc_ids_ops_context_filter(const struct bpf_prog *prog, u32 kfunc_id)
+{
+ u32 moff, flags;
+
+ if (!btf_id_set8_contains(&scx_kfunc_ids_ops_context, kfunc_id))
+ return 0;
+
+ if (prog->type == BPF_PROG_TYPE_SYSCALL &&
+ btf_id_set8_contains(&scx_kfunc_ids_unlocked, kfunc_id))
+ return 0;
+
+ if (prog->type == BPF_PROG_TYPE_STRUCT_OPS &&
+ prog->aux->st_ops != &bpf_sched_ext_ops)
+ return 0;
+
+ /* prog->type == BPF_PROG_TYPE_STRUCT_OPS && prog->aux->st_ops == &bpf_sched_ext_ops*/
+
+ moff = prog->aux->attach_st_ops_member_off;
+ flags = scx_ops_context_flags[SCX_MOFF_IDX(moff)];
+
+ if ((flags & SCX_OPS_KF_UNLOCKED) &&
+ btf_id_set8_contains(&scx_kfunc_ids_unlocked, kfunc_id))
+ return 0;
+
+ if ((flags & SCX_OPS_KF_CPU_RELEASE) &&
+ btf_id_set8_contains(&scx_kfunc_ids_cpu_release, kfunc_id))
+ return 0;
+
+ if ((flags & SCX_OPS_KF_DISPATCH) &&
+ btf_id_set8_contains(&scx_kfunc_ids_dispatch, kfunc_id))
+ return 0;
+
+ if ((flags & SCX_OPS_KF_ENQUEUE) &&
+ btf_id_set8_contains(&scx_kfunc_ids_enqueue_dispatch, kfunc_id))
+ return 0;
+
+ if ((flags & SCX_OPS_KF_SELECT_CPU) &&
+ btf_id_set8_contains(&scx_kfunc_ids_select_cpu, kfunc_id))
+ return 0;
+
+ return -EACCES;
+}
